Output 4efd17368651622878031c5a6e869dba802354127a61c9c1e7a10c99e352014e:1

value
5707350
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c951cda1b3feb1b6b934644fb02c090efd12bd2b OP_EQUAL
address
3L3VjtdfoU8EBzaWWAAYZ7ZRuyThrEzPv7
transaction
4efd17368651622878031c5a6e869dba802354127a61c9c1e7a10c99e352014e
spent
true